Leeds United
- Leeds are in the bottom half of the Premier League and need points to keep clear of the relegation scrap, while a City win would keep them in the title race.
- Leeds, by contrast, have had a mixed bag of results in their last five matches, showing a bit of resilience by taking draws against Aston Villa and Chelsea, but also being well beaten by Arsenal in a 0-4 home defeat.
- Leeds’ formation is compact and features wing-backs who are always looking to get forward, so there is a chance for them to manufacture some chaos and hit the visitors on the counter-attack.
- Leeds will be desperate and could cause problems if Farke gets his tactics right and the set pieces work on Saturday.
Manchester City
- City are on a roll, with four wins and a draw in their last five games in the Premier League and Champions League, including recent victories over Newcastle, Fulham and Liverpool.
- The sky blues are scoring freely again and Erling Haaland has rediscovered his scoring touch with recent goals in both the Premier League and Champions League.
- Guardiola’s skill has been to rotate his squad so that City are as dangerous as ever across all competitions while also producing superb match-winning performances from stars and emerging talents.
- Rayan Cherki and Antoine Semenyo have both added spark to City’s attack recently, with the former providing some flair and assists while the latter has come in to score goals and make an instant impact since joining.
- Nico O’Reilly is another emerging talent, contributing goals and creativity from advanced midfield roles in recent weeks.
Head-to-Head
City have dominated the two clubs in recent years, winning the last five meetings in all competitions, including a 7 - 0 triumph in December 2021.

- Leeds United
- Dominic Calvert-Lewin is their top scorer with around 10 goals in the league and always poses an aerial threat.
- Anton Stach is another set-piece specialist, having curled in a stunning free-kick for Leeds at Villa Park recently, while Brenden Aaronson and Ilia Gruev are the energy and creativity at the heart of Leeds’ midfield, feeding the breaks and counter-attacks.
